Transaction 20edbb0b773b6cf46fbaed4ac198f1f0593cf0d4419bceea6c234ae169170e51
1 Input
1 Output
-
20edbb0b773b6cf46fbaed4ac198f1f0593cf0d4419bceea6c234ae169170e51:0
- value
- 650436
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b836053c16afb86dd0d7ae6cd68c5bd4e1b27ec
- address
- bc1qtwpkq57pdtacdhgd0tnv66x9h48pkflvru9n40